Utah
The Jazz have lost six of their last ten games, but they’ve remained competitive in recent weeks. Vegas has the Jazz listed as 6-point underdogs in a game that features a total of 203.5 points. They draw a favorable matchup against the Suns, who are ranked 28th in points allowed per game and 24th in rebounding differential this season.

Gordon Hayward (FD: $8100, DK: $7800 / MPG: 35 / Usage Rate: 25)
Small forward is always a thin position, especially on FanDuel where we have to roster two of them. Hayward finds himself in a great spot tonight against the Suns, who have allowed the fourth-most fantasy points to small forwards this season. If the Jazz are going to keep this game as close as the oddsmakers expect, it will likely be on the back of the Butler alum.
Phoenix
The Suns have lost three games in a row and are quickly losing ground in the Western Conference playoff picture. Tonight they host a slow-paced Jazz team, that has held their opponents to an average of 98.6 points per game. Alex Len will not play tonight. His minutes will be soaked up by Miles Plumlee, Markieff Morris, and Brandan Wright.

Markieff Morris (FD: $6400, DK: $5900 / MPG: 31 / Usage Rate: 22.9)
Morris is one of the best values at power forward tonight, especially on DraftKings. Len’s absence should bolster Morris’ fantasy appeal. He has been terrific over his last five outings, averaging 29 fantasy points per game. He deserves the elite play tag tonight against the Jazz.

San Antonio
The Spurs are one of my least favorite teams to see on the schedule, especially when they are double-digit favorites. Coach Popovich plays his veterans the absolute minimum necessary to pick up the win. With 11 other games on the schedule, we can avoid all of the Spurs tonight in a potential blowout.
